Who Said It?

“I can’t imagine public service without faith. I don’t know how anyone could serve, absent that enormous strength.”
A) Abraham Lincoln
B) Peter Parker
C) Katherine Harris
D) Marc Gellman
E) Kirk Kameron
So, are we conclude that all good Americans who might be unaffiliated, indifferent, or even atheist or agnostic, are incapable of engaging in public service and that only those with so-called “faith” on their sleeve have the strength to do so? Words of wonder from the one who claims candidacy is the will of God, though that will cost ten million dollars.
